Why Sewage Backups Hit Lyon Hard
The pattern in Lyon is consistent. aging clay sewer laterals collapsing under saturated soil during hurricane season drives most of the emergency restoration calls we get.
Lyon, Mississippi experiences frequent heavy rainfall and flooding during the summer months, which can cause clay sewer lines to collapse. The saturated soil combined with outdated infrastructure increases the likelihood of sewage backups in residential areas.
